Claudia, who immortalized immaturity in the earlier books, is now 30, 12 years married, and off to Europe with David, the faithful Bertha, and the two youngsters for a vacation which Julia and Hartley's death (and money) has made possible. Still young at heart, Claudia has new life experiences to face: seasickness; her first drinks; jealousy of Linda Harwell- on shipboard, then of another woman once in England; apprehension over David's non-appearance; a trip to the Continent and a short dream of David's retirement to a farm in Aix- until they are called home..... It is all reassuringly unchanged and familiar, and Claudia is still growing up for that audience (not to be minimized) which has not outgrown her.
